ABSTRACTElection malpractice is a frightening specter in democratic countries. As aconsequence, election integrity is often violated in the electoral process. This studyseeks to discuss the political dynamics of the concepts of electoral malpractice andelection integrity in an electoral setting in a flawed democratic regime withprocedural characteristics. Election malpractices which are widely practiced inflawed democratic regimes have been proven to not only distort the quality ofelections with integrity, but also slowly have the potential to kill democracy. In thepractice of elections that lack integrity, it is difficult to find a fair electoral process, which is free from interference and interference from the authorities. By using asearch of relevant literature, the concept of electoral malpractice is an integral partof the concept of political science which is characterized by illusion. It has thepotential to continue to disrupt the electoral process. It will be intertwined with thenature of populist autocratic regimes, weakening mass media and social networks tomobilize change. In fact, electoral malpractice has distorted the principles offreedom, fairness and competition of elections with integrity. Only through credibleand legitimate election channels, elections with integrity and quality democraticperformance will be realized.Keyword: election integrity, election malpractice, flawed democracy, undemocraticregimes
